Who we are:

Tinuiti is the largest independent full-funnel marketing agency in the U.S. across the media that matters most, with $4 billion in digital media under management and more than 1,200 employees. Built for marketers who demand growth and accountability, Tinuiti unites media and measurement under one roof to eliminate waste—the biggest growth killer of all—and scale what works. Its proprietary technology, Bliss Point by Tinuiti, reveals the truth around growth and waste, and how to capitalize on it. With expert teams across Commerce, Search, Social, TV & Audio, and more, Tinuiti delivers measurable results with brutal simplicity: Love Growth. Hate Waste.

Key responsibilities

Client‑Centric

  • Own the client growth agenda and executive relationships; align strategies to P&L, customer journey, and board‑level outcomes; frame trade‑offs and secure decisions in QBRs/steercos.

  • Lead onboarding, transitions, and escalations; ensure transparency and trust; drive renewal, expansion, and cross‑sell; support strategic new business narratives.

  • Translate tactical media into business impact; ensure QA/operational excellence and test‑and‑learn discipline across the Pod.

Product‑Led

  • Embed Bliss Point across clients (Rapid MMM, Always‑On Incrementality, Brand Equity, Creative Insights, Forecasting, Customer Insights) to inform allocation, testing, and growth hypotheses; close feedback loops with Product/Analytics.

  • Govern adoption of platform automation/AI (e.g., value‑based bidding, PMax) with clear guardrails, enablement, and stage‑gates; ensure product‑led onboarding and measurement.

Data & Measurement‑Driven

  • Institutionalize hypothesis‑driven planning: Pod‑level test roadmaps with powered designs (control/holdout where feasible), decision thresholds, tolerances, and read cadences.

  • Ensure data quality (tags, feeds, UTM/GA4); communicate model caveats; require financial narratives (forecast vs. actual) and sensitivity analysis for major decisions.

The Tinuiti Way

  • Orchestrate cross‑channel strategy (SEM, SEO, Social, Retail Media/Marketplaces, Lifecycle/CRM, Creative) with clear measurement; educate clients on trade‑offs; codify frameworks/playbooks; bring cutting‑edge tactics rooted in business value.

Owner Mindset

  • Co‑own Pod financials with VP: margin, utilization, pricing/SOWs, staffing/capacity; eliminate process/spend waste and improve operating excellence.

  • Align team Rocks and KPIs to client and Pod priorities; proactively drive cross‑sell and strategic new business opportunities.

People Leader

  • Build and lead high‑performing teams and managers: clear goals and Rocks, weekly 1:1s, timely feedback, capability development, and succession pipeline; hire and onboard well.

  • Install governance (standards, scorecards, QA cadences, enablement) that sustains performance and consistency across teams; champion change and engagement.

Professional & Technical Qualifications

  • 12+ years leading multi‑million‑dollar client engagements in performance marketing; repeated success driving growth and efficiency at enterprise scale.

  • 6+ years people management (managing managers and ICs), including hiring, coaching, performance management, and succession planning.

  • Executive relationship management; expert communication and expectation setting; adept at escalations and change leadership.

  • Cross‑channel literacy (SEM, SEO, Social, Retail Media/Marketplaces, Lifecycle/CRM, Creative) with strong measurement acumen (forecasting, KPI trees, incrementality/MMM literacy).

  • Bliss Point fluency (or similar platform): translate MMM/Incrementality/Forecasting/Brand Equity/Creative Insights into allocation and testing decisions; partner effectively with Product/Analytics.

  • Financial acumen: margin/utilization management, pricing/SOWs, capacity planning, and accurate forecasting across a Pod.

  • Education/certifications: BA/BS required; advanced degree preferred or equivalent experience; Google/Microsoft certifications a plus.

KPIs

  • Client retention and satisfaction; revenue growth (expansion/cross‑sell) and win rate on new business influenced.

  • Efficiency and growth: meet/beat efficiency KPIs while growing revenue contribution; validated reallocations informed by Bliss Point.

  • Forecast accuracy and governance: plan vs. actual within tolerance; decision logs with thresholds/tolerances; adoption of experiments/product features.

  • Pod financials: margin/utilization within targets; staffing/capacity aligned to priority.

  • Data/ops quality: tag/feed integrity; time‑to‑resolution; issue prevention.

  • People outcomes: engagement/retention of key roles; certifications; capability growth and succession readiness.

  • Cross‑channel impact: measurable lift from integrated plans (Tinuiti Way).

What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ene

Home to t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, Seattle punches far above its weight in innovation. But its surrounding mountains, sprinkled with world-famous hiking trails and climbing routes, make the city a destination for outdoorsy types as well. Established as a logging town before shifting to shipbuilding and logistics, the Emerald City is now known for its contributions to aerospace, software, biotech and cloud computing. And its status as a thriving tech ecosystem is attracting out-of-town companies looking to establish new tech and engineering hubs.

Key Facts About Seattle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
